Workspace

The new Workspace command allows to create, modify and save current workspaces. You can customize ribbon or classic workspace to suit interface environment needs much easier.

Right-Click + Drag Method

The right-click+drag method allows users to move, copy or paste selected objects as block by right-clicking and dragging the objects while holding the right button down.

Selection Cycling

With the new Selection Cycling system variable you can quickly select overlapped or coincident objects in current drawing as well as set selection cycling options.
